  • 摘要: 应用LS-DYNA显式程序,基于多物质的ALE有限元法,利用罚函数实现了爆炸冲击波与玻璃幕墙结构间的耦合作用,重现了玻璃幕墙防爆炸实验中爆炸荷载的产生及其与玻璃幕墙相互作用的三维动态过程。研究了爆炸冲击波作用下幕墙结构的动态响应行为,分析了幕墙内外层玻璃的破坏情况。研究表明,数值模拟结果与实验结果一致,这为玻璃幕墙的抗爆设计及改进提供了重要的参考依据。
